Christian Health Center, located in Hopkinsville, Kentucky, operates as a nursing home facility with additional senior living services. It is a certified participant in Medicare and Medicaid, offering care options since March 1978. The center provides a combination of skilled nursing, rehabilitation, long-term care, and continuing care tailored to elderly residents needing assistance with daily activities or specialized medical attention. With a capacity for 100 occupants, the facility emphasizes compassionate, faith-based care supported by both resident and family counseling services. On-site amenities include vision, hearing, and dental care, along with a barber/beauty salon and laundry/dry cleaning services to ensure residents' everyday needs are met.
Transportation at Christian Health Center is available for both medical and non-medical purposes through scheduled transportation services. This transport arrangement allows residents to attend medical appointments, shop for personal necessities, or participate in community activities, enhancing their autonomy and quality of life.

Costs at this community start at $6,600 and range up to $6,996. The average price in the community is $6,798, which is more than the average price in the area of $5,166. The cost of nursing homes in this area is essentially the same as the cost throughout the state. If the resident needs other services, additional services may increase the monthly cost.
